Since 2021, ARB proposed that the Part 1, 2 & 3 Architecture course be discontinued and just have an 'academic course' and 'practical course'. Certainly that would be the right move! 
From the ARB report: One stakeholder interviewee said, “When people qualify, there is a disconnect between professional practice and design. It should be more integrated.” Another quote was: Over 80% of those recruiting architects said that applicants lacked the levels of competence required by the firm, primarily reporting a lack of necessary skills and knowledge relating to building contracts, health and safety risks, and procurement.
